4th Annual Cloud Place Youth Fusion Teen Film SeriesWinter/Spring 2008

Screenings in February, March, and May

Cloud Place
647 Boylston Street
Copley Square
Boston

Curated by Teen Filmmakers from the Boston area

SUBMISSION INFORMATION - NO ENTRY FEE
Deadline for February show: received by January 4, 2008
(PLEASE do not wait until the deadline--if your film is completed now, send it to us!)

Formats accepted: VHS, DVD, mini-DV (PLEASE label with contact info & film length)

Maximum length: 20 minutes

All categories accepted: documentary, fiction, experimental, music video, etc.

Age limit: 19 (filmmaker must have been 19 or under when film was made)

Work produced within the last 3 years

CALL FOR ENTRIES

The Free Speech Shorts Video Festival is an event explore First Amendment ideals of free speech and free expression by showcasing selected video works submitted by people in Cambridge and the Greater Boston area. CCTV is accepting entries for its 2nd Annual Free Speech Shorts Video Festival! Entries should be innovative, provide an alternative voice, and be original in content. Submissions should be 10 minutes or less and may be in any style, language* or genre. Submissions must be received by Wednesday, December 12. All are encouraged to submit. There is no cost to submit or to screen (if your video is selected). The event includes a screening that will be held on January 30, 2008. No admission will be charged for the screening, as this is a free event and open to the public.

SUBMISSION DETAILS

o Submit a DVD with the Submission Agreement Form
o Total running time must be 10 minutes or less
o Entries in other language must have English subtitles*
o Clearly mark each tape with: the Production Title, Producer’s name, Category for Submissions, and exact running time
o This year’s Categories for Submission are: Documentary, Non-Documentary, Youth Documentary, and Youth Non-Documentary
o Read and sign the Submission Agreement- to be posted soon!
o Submit material to: CCTV's 2nd Annual Free Speech Shorts Video Festival, c/o Cambridge Community Television 675 Massachusetts Avenue, Cambridge MA 02139
o Submissions must be received by Wednesday, December 12, 2007
o Submitted tapes can be picked up at the station for one week after the Festival. Tapes not picked up by the producer become the property of CCTV. Producers retain all rights to their work.
